Luciano Caramel (born 1935 in Como, Italy) is an Italian art critic and art historian. In the 1980s he was an assistant director of the Accademia di Belle Arti di Brera in Milan. He taught contemporary art at the Università Cattolica del Sacro Cuore in Milan. He is an expert on the work of Medardo Rosso. His publications include Arte in Italia 1945-1960, a university textbook.
A festschrift dedicated to him, Il presente si fa storia, scritti in onore di Luciano Caramel, was published in 2008.
